+"""
+Common utilities for OpenLMI python providers.
+"""
+def parse_instance_id(instance_id, classname=None):
+ """
+ Parse InstanceID, check it has LMI:<classname>:<ID> format and return
+ the ID. Return None if the format is bad.
+ :param instance_id: (``string``) String to parse.
+ :param classname: (``string``) Name of class, whose InstanceID we parse.
+ If the classname is None, it won't be checked.
+ :returns: ``string`` with the ID.
+ """
+ parts = instance_id.split(":", 2)
+ if len(parts) != 3:
+ return None
+ if parts[0] != "LMI":
+ return None
+ real_classname = parts[1]
+ if classname and real_classname.lower() != classname.lower():
+ return None
+ return parts[2]
